Elgin Police Seek Help Finding Missing Juvenile (patch.com) β Elgin police are asking residents to help locate missing juvenile Madison Beese, who was last seen leaving her home on Castle Pines Circle the night of Sept. 11. Detectives remain in close contact with her family and are sharing her description, distinctive tattoo, and piercings to aid recognition. Community members are urged to call or text tips directly to Elgin police using the provided numbers and keyword.

Film director Kevin Smith's bringing his unique comedy view to Hemmens in Elgin (chicagotribune.com) β Kevin Smith is bringing his stand-up comedy and Q&A show to The Hemmens Cultural Center in Elgin this Friday, giving local fans a rare chance to see him live close to home. He'll share stories from his film career, talk about his vegan lifestyle, and interact with the audience during a 90-minute to two-hour set.

U-46 students are learning Spanish from teachers who hail from Spain (chicagotribune.com) β Students in Elgin-based School District U-46 are learning Spanish from teachers recruited directly from Spain and Puerto Rico, including one who previously taught at Lowrie Elementary School in Elgin. The district's long-running international hiring program helps fill bilingual teaching needs while giving local kids exposure to authentic language and culture, even as teachers adjust to Midwest winters and new school settings.

Cook County latest reported home sales for week ending Sept. 5 (southcooknews.com) β Recent Cook County home-sale records include several Elgin properties, such as a Southeast Elgin house on Campus Drive and two Northeast Elgin homes on Aspen Court and Springhill Court, with sale prices from $285,000 to $415,000. For Elgin homeowners and buyers, the list offers a snapshot of neighborhood values and property tax levels compared with other Chicago-area communities.
